Dow Corning Adds Blends, Masterbatches to Silane Solutions Lineup
Simplifies Compounding for Crosslinked Polyethylene MIDLAND, Mich.- August 24, 2006- Dow Corning has introduced a family of pre-blended silanes for crosslinking polyethylene that simplifies compounding when making crosslinked PE pipe (PEX) in a one- or two-step process or making crosslinked PE wire and cable insulation (XLPE) in a one-step process.
